Title: Quick Question about hard drives
Post by: fearingsept on August 18, 2008, 06:48:09 pm
In my core I have 2 250Gb hard drives. I am getting a warning that says disk space is getting low. I took a look at my disk space. I show that one is of my 250Gb drives is almost full and the other is empty. I thought LMCE was supposed to just use whatever drive you have available for storage if set up that way by default. The second drive has no OS and was completely blank when I installed LMCE. Is there something I need to do to make this drive active?

Did you tell the system that the drive could be used automaticly when lmce asked what to do with the drive?

I believe I have told it to use it automatically. Is there a way for me to check to be sure and change the setting if I need to?

Yeah, just look the drive up in the device manager of the web-admin, should have a checkbox "Use Automatically".
